Red Giant Magic Bullet Film 1.2.3 is a specialized plugin designed to give digital footage the authentic aesthetic of real motion picture film by emulating the entire photochemical process. Key Features

Features a mathematically accurate grain engine that adjusts based on image brightness, plus a vintage/modern slider to control the overall intensity of the effect. Integration and Workflow How to Use Magic Bullet Film

Includes 22 different industry-standard negative stocks (such as various Kodak and Fujifilm options) to define the base color and grain structure.

Offers 4 specific print stocks for the final "look" of the film, providing a total of 88 unique cinematic combinations when paired with negatives.

Unlike simple LUTs, it models the interaction between negative and print stages, allowing you to adjust exposure between them to mimic filmic overexposure or "pulling" stock.

Built for real-time performance, allowing you to see adjustments immediately on your timeline without lengthy rendering breaks.
